    In reference to 12/14/2021 Board of Supervisors Agenda, both items 5e and 5f:

    Words matter.

    In discussions today concerning the Board of Supervisors Ad Hoc Committees I’d like to bring your attention the imbalanced use of the word “crisis”.

    Fire, drought, and COVID can all be described as crisis. Because Ad Hoc Committees are direct with factual precise statements of mission, the word crisis is not necessarily, and understandably, not included in these Ad Hoc titles or descriptions.

    However, the word crisis is used in a heavily imbalanced, subjective nature with regards to the Index document statement “Ad Hoc Committee to work on County Policy or Policies to address the local short term rental crisis”

    Crisis is not a factual description here, especially for a committee that is looking to be open minded in their research and consideration of such matters.

    As to 5f, I ask to have the word “crisis” striken from the active Ad Hoc Committee Index line currently listed as “11/16/2021 Formation of an Ad Hoc Committee to work on County Policy or Policies to address the local short term rental crisis” and any future reference of that nature.

    And reference to 5e, please include these comments in respect to 2021 Index of Standing Committees “Review complete list of Board Directives”
